About Craven Nursing Home:
After joining the Spellman Care family in 2004, Craven Nursing Home quickly became a highly regarded Home of choice for many locals. This modern, spacious setting, continues the Spellman family legacy of providing friendly, person-centred care built on trust and compassion.
Nestled in its own grounds within the picturesque market town of Skipton, the Home offers wonderful views over the countryside and beyond. Crucially, the Home backs onto the stunning Leeds and Liverpool Canal, and the fields and moorland beyond, offering beautiful, tranquil views throughout the year. A much-looked-forward-to event is the annual summer trip out on an accessible canal boat, allowing residents to fully enjoy the famous local waterways.
The Home features 64 light and spacious rooms, all equipped with an en suite lavatory. Each room is stylishly decorated, and we strongly encourage our residents to personalise their space to make it feel truly their own. Our large, comfortable lounges and dining rooms are designed as wonderful social spaces, inviting residents to interact and build friendships within the community.
